Installed a set of Dansk double bubble tips ( similar to TechArt style ) on the Turbo . The smaller tip is just a dummy as the exhaust pipe connects to the larger tip only. But... there is a crescent shaped cut out between the two tips ( like a horn instrument) so when the boost comes in AND heavy or rapid throttle is applied , the exhaust gas velocity gets fast enough to produce a loud ( esp with windows down ) continuous multi-harmonic rising frequency shreik . Combined with the lower roar of the exhaust , it sounds like a commercial jetliner at takeoff all the way to redline .
You can also reverse L/R tips and instead of protruding straight out, they are angled up like on some Lamborghhini V12s . Totally controlled by the throttle foot - only heard when you get on it. It's nuts! hilarious |
